[font/draw] Move slanting to font layer
I moved it to the draw layer in 11.0.0; That was a bad design:
font-funcs should NOT be responsible for synthetic bold & slant.
This design reverts that and makes the font layer apply it,
using a recording.
This is a minor API change from 11.0.0 since hb_draw_state_t::slant_xy
which was introduced in 11.0.0, is removed now. I believe no client
had started using it. It was only relevant to other font-funcs draw
implementations.

[COLRv1:ot/ft] Use paint-bounded instead of paint-extents
Faster. Note that this also means that if there is no clip-box,
we don't compute the bounds and emit an initial clip anymore.
That was totally unnecessary and against the COLRv1 rendering
algorithm.
This makes painting of COLRv1 fonts without clipboxes *much*
faster, as previously we were computing bounds using all subglyph
outlines. Not anymore.
Before:
BM_Font/paint_glyph/Nupuram-Color.colrv1.ttf/ot 1.78 ms
After:
BM_Font/paint_glyph/Nupuram-Color.colrv1.ttf/ot 0.155 ms
